I have bid on alot of salvage vipers, no $31K is not high for a retail buyer if it has low miles and minimal damage. PLEASE-tram under the car and check squareness of the frame!! Frame damage is typical and not evident unless you measure. Look for kinked rails and flaked off paint as well. You can get hoods with minimum damage for about $1000 and damage free for about $5000. I don't know Ky requirements on salvage titles every state has differant requirements and some are more difficult than others. Do some reasearch and know what you have to document before you by and begin repairs. Nothing like having the car done and the state will not title it because you did not have a recipt with vin number to the used hood you bought from a junk dealer. Be aware if you ever do sell or trade, it will be difficult (but not impossible if the car is done right!) Do you know a good body and frame guy you can take to look at the car with you? If you have less than $40K in this car to fix it right and it has low miles you'll do OK!

Just going by my experience. In the past 3 months I know of two cars with fairly minimal damage that went for around $15K. One had a salvage title, the other didn't. The one with the salvage title had bent upper frame rails and attributed largely to it being totalled.
